Winning a contract with a public agency or a state productive company is the hard part; collecting on time is the other. The public payment cycle is not negotiable — but it can be advanced. IT Capital structures contract advancement and purchase-order financing collateralized by the assignment of collection rights, so the supplier can execute, buy inputs and make payroll without waiting for the budget cycle to close.

The progress estimate mechanism

Who authorizes it, how often and under what criteria. It is what turns a contract into a dated cash flow.

The assignment of rights before the entity

PEMEX, CFE or a major contractor each have their own procedure. Knowing them is half the work.

Installed capacity to execute

Winning the tender and being able to deliver are two different things, and financing only makes sense if both are true.
